DNS(Domain Name System,域名系统)是一种用于将主机名或域名转换为IP地址的服务。在武汉,DNS服务的使用与其他地区并无本质区别,它依赖于分布在全球范围内的DNS服务器网络来解析域名。
基础概念:
- 域名:如www.example.com,是人类易于记忆和使用的地址形式。
- IP地址:如192.168.1.1,是计算机在网络中的唯一标识。
- DNS解析:将域名转换为对应的IP地址的过程。
优势:
- 易于记忆:相比IP地址,域名更易于记忆和使用。
- 灵活方便:更改网站地址时,只需更新DNS记录,无需更改所有指向该网站的链接。
- 负载均衡:通过DNS解析,可以将请求分发到多个服务器,实现负载均衡。
类型:
- 权威DNS:存储特定域名的DNS记录,并负责响应对该域名的查询。
- 递归DNS:向其他DNS服务器查询,并将结果返回给请求者。
- 缓存DNS:存储最近查询过的DNS记录,以加速后续查询。
应用场景:
- 网站访问:用户通过输入域名来访问网站,浏览器会通过DNS解析获取网站的IP地址。
- 邮件服务:邮件服务器通过DNS解析来查找目标邮箱服务器的IP地址。
- 云服务:在云环境中,DNS用于解析云资源的域名,如云数据库、云存储等。
可能遇到的问题及解决方法:
- DNS解析失败:
- 原因:可能是DNS服务器故障、网络问题或域名配置错误。
- 解决方法:检查网络连接,更换DNS服务器,或联系域名注册商检查域名配置。
- DNS缓存污染:
- 原因:恶意DNS服务器或网络攻击可能导致DNS缓存被污染。
- 解决方法:清除本地DNS缓存,或使用安全的DNS服务。
- DNS劫持:
- 原因:攻击者可能篡改DNS查询结果,将流量重定向到恶意网站。
- 解决方法:使用加密的DNS服务,如DNS over HTTPS(DoH),或配置防火墙来阻止恶意流量。
在武汉地区,如果遇到DNS相关问题,可以考虑使用当地的DNS服务提供商,或者选择知名的公共DNS服务,如腾讯云DNS等。这些服务通常提供稳定、快速的DNS解析,并具备一定的安全防护能力。
参考链接: